- a wireless network conforming to the IEEE 802.11 standard consists of two modes of use: infrastructure BSS (Infrastructure BSS) and Independent BSS (aka ah hoc).
- the infrastructure BSS includes an access point (AP) and a distributed system (DS).
- the BSS is an AP used in all communication processes including communication between devices.
- the infrastructure BSS generally transmits frames through the AP.
- IBSS refers to a BSS that forms a network of devices without an AP and does not allow access to a distributed system (DS).
- DCF distributed coordination function
- the WLAN defines a Direct Link Setting (DLS) procedure for direct communication between Q devices (QoS devices). Accordingly, the Q devices establish a direct link between Q devices by exchanging DLS request frames and DLS response frames through the QoS AP or the legacy AP.
- DLS Direct Link Setting
- the IEEE 802.11ad Task Group supports the directional communication and QoS in the millimeter wave of the 60GHz band, which is being recently standardized.
- the IEEE 802.11ad Task Group excludes only the portion of the infrastructure BSS that connects to the Internet to improve power saving and spectrum management.
- the IEEE 802.11ad Task Group has a coordinator to perform resource management and network management, and newly adopts Personal IBSS (PBSS), which brings the peer-to-peer communication function of IBSS. It was.
- PBSS Personal IBSS
- PBSS Control Point (PCP) of PBSS is a coordinator that supports most of the functions of the access point (AP) except for the part that supports communication with other networks by connecting to distributed system (DS). to be.

- WLAN Beacon Interval is a (Beacon Time) BT, Association Beam Forming Training (A-BFT) 220, Announce Time (AT) 230 and Data Transfer Time (DTT) 240).
- Beacon Time BT
- A-BFT Association Beam Forming Training
- AT Announce Time
- DTT Data Transfer Time
- Beacon Time (BT) 210 indicates the time for discovering new devices (STAs) and requesting resources from the coordinator device.
- A-BFT 220 may include, for example, a coordinator device such as an access point (AP) or a PBSS control point (PCP) and other devices (eg, source device, destination). Time for beamforming between the device and the relay device).
- a coordinator device such as an access point (AP) or a PBSS control point (PCP) and other devices (eg, source device, destination). Time for beamforming between the device and the relay device).
- AP access point
- PCP PBSS control point
- other devices eg, source device, destination. Time for beamforming between the device and the relay device.
- Announce Time (AT) 230 indicates a time at which a coordinator device, such as an AP or PCP, informs devices in a network using a beacon frame or an announce frame.
- the data transfer time (DTT) 240 includes a service period (SP) and a contention-based period (CBP) in which frame exchange between devices is performed.

- the access point (AP) or pico-net coordinator (PNC) (wPAN) divides the time zone into a competitive and non-competitive interval, allowing data to be transmitted in a competitive and non-competitive scheme. have.
- the AP or PNC transmits data exclusively in a specific time domain of the non-competition period by using a polling technique or a method of transmitting scheduling information.
- a scheduling scheme may be used for broadcasting scheduling information in a non-competition section not used by other devices.
- the non-competition period requests a reservation resource that can transmit a frame transmitted to a peer-to-peer via a relay device as well as a direct path and allocates such a resource. How to do it.
- a device requesting peer communication is called a source device
- a device responding to a request for peer communication is called a destination device
- a device relaying a frame between two devices is defined as a relay device.
- the source device wants to ask the coordinator device for a resource reservation that may send data to the destination device via the relay device.
- the coordinator device may be an AP of a WLAN, but is not limited thereto, and all coordinators supporting a function such as an AP may correspond to the coordinator device.
- an ID of a device requesting a resource (defined as an initiator ID) and an ID of a device (referred to as a response ID) to which the requested device wants to communicate are informed.
- an initiator ID may be omitted in a field sent when the initiator requesting a resource.
- a traffic ID may be added to differently apply a quality of service (QoS) according to characteristics of data to be transmitted.
- QoS quality of service
- a resource may be requested using an ADDTS request frame including a TSPEC IE field defining other traffic related parameters, and a traffic stream (TS) may be set after negotiation with the AP.
- HCOP Polled Transmission Opportunity
- the 802.11 specification does not propose a method for requesting and allocating a section for peer-to-peer in a non-competition section.
- a scheme using Channel Time Allocation (CTA) of 802.15 and Distributed Reservation Protocol (DRP) of ECMA 368,387 which performs reservation for such peer-to-peer, may relay traffic of this peer-to-peer. It is not dealing with.
- CTA Channel Time Allocation
- DRP Distributed Reservation Protocol
- the general reservation scheme should include the initiator ID (identifier ID or address) and responder ID in the requesting frame.
- the start time and duration of the allocated time together with the initiator ID and the responder ID are notified to distinguish each allocated section into these IDs.
- the coordinator device may broadcast the allocated information using a beacon frame or an announcement frame.
- the device listens to this and checks whether there is an ID among the allocated resources, and if there is an ID among the allocated resources, the devices transmit data in the allocated interval. Using an initiator ID and a responder ID here indicates that only these two devices are allowed to use that reserved segment.
